框架选型与设计:网站构建核心技术精析
|
在网站构建过程中,框架选型是决定项目成败的关键一步。不同的框架适用于不同规模与需求的项目。例如,React 适合构建高度交互的单页应用,其组件化设计让界面逻辑清晰且易于维护;Vue 则以轻量和渐进式著称,对初学者友好,适合快速搭建原型或中小型项目。而 Angular 作为全功能框架,提供了完整的解决方案,适合大型企业级应用,但学习曲线较陡。
2026AI模拟图,仅供参考 设计阶段需充分考虑可扩展性与团队协作效率。一个良好的架构应具备清晰的模块划分,如将数据层、视图层与逻辑层分离,避免代码耦合。采用前后端分离模式能提升开发灵活性,前端专注于用户体验,后端专注业务逻辑与数据安全。同时,统一的接口规范与状态管理机制(如 Redux、Pinia)有助于维持应用状态的一致性。性能优化也是设计中不可忽视的部分。通过懒加载、代码分割与缓存策略,可以显著减少首屏加载时间。使用服务工作线程(Service Worker)实现离线支持,进一步提升用户访问体验。响应式设计确保网站在移动端与桌面端均表现良好,提升跨设备兼容性。 安全性同样需要贯穿整个设计流程。输入验证、防止跨站脚本攻击(XSS)、使用 HTTPS 加密传输,都是基础但关键的防护措施。框架本身也应定期更新,以修复已知漏洞。选择活跃维护的开源框架,能获得更及时的安全补丁与社区支持。 最终,框架的选择与设计不应只看技术先进性,更应结合团队能力、项目周期与长期维护成本。合适的框架如同坚实的地基,支撑起高效开发与稳定运行的网站体系。只有在技术与实际需求之间找到平衡,才能真正实现高质量的网站构建。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

